量子计算与区块链碰撞后——量子区块链
在一项最新研究中,科学家提出了一个“量子区块链”的概念设计,或许能让区块链系统免受量子计算机黑客的攻击。新的编码程序可以被诠释为非经典地影响着过去;因此这种去中心化的量子区块链可以被视作为一个量子网络化的时间机器。
区块链是一种经典数据库类型,它存储着与过去有关的信息,例如财务或其他交易历史记录。独特的设计使它难以被篡改,并且不需要一个中央机构来维持其持续的准确性。区块链最著名的应用便是众所周知的比特币,但近几年各种创业公司、企业联盟和研究项目已经探索出了区块链技术的许多其他潜在用途。
根据2015年世界经济论坛调查显示:到2027年,预计全球GDP的10%将可以被储存在区块链技术中。
但是,区块链可能会因另一项即将到来的重大技术而面临麻烦——那就是量子计算机。传统计算机通过控制晶体管的开启或关闭,将数据表示为1和0,而量子计算机使用的则是量子比特。由于量子物理所具有的一部分超现实特性,量子比特可以处于同时为0和1的叠加状态。
现在俄罗斯科学家已经研发出了一种量子技术来保障各区块链的安全。也就是说,这种全新的区块链加密方法利用的恰恰是对区块链本身造成安全威胁的量子计算技术。
在位于莫斯科的俄罗斯国家量子研究中心,研究者Evgeny Kiktenko及其团队已经设计、建造以及测试了首个量子区块链系统。顾名思义,该系统将以量子加密技术保障区块链的安全。目前,该技术已投入到了商业应用中。
Evgeny Kiktenko 团队所搭建的量子识别系统是基于坚实可靠的物理法则来解决共识机制问题,它可以保证参与的每一方都能安全准确的对另一方进行身份验证。同时,由于每个人的“量子信息”都是和所有交易相关联的,所以信息变得相对公开,篡改起来也就没有那么容易。
Evgeny Kiktenko表示,他们已经使用瑞士公司ID Quantique的商用量子加密系统搭建起了一个上文所描述的量子识别系统。他们说:“我们已经开发了一种基于信息理论安全认证的区块链协议,在这个网络中,每对节点都是通过量子密钥分发链路相连接。”
为了验证量子区块链技术的可行性,该团队已经在拥有四个用户的网络中进行了测试,其中一个用户试图通过做出双倍的支出来验证系统的可靠性。“这个协议仅仅通过两轮信息沟通就识别出、并取消了双倍支出的交易申请,并且在同一时间就形成了只允许进行合法交易的区块。”
无论如何,量子技术的发展就是这样,成熟的量子计算机既可以攻克任何使用传统密码技术保存的信息,它也可以被用来和区块链技术结合,提升密码保护的安全等级。不得不说,技术就是在这样的自我矛盾之中一点一点进步的。
文章来源:it168